Why These Are the Top Roofing Contractors in Aurora

Aurora's roofing market is characterized by a high demand for storm resilience due to its location in the Ohio Valley, which is prone to severe thunderstorms, hail, high winds, and the occasional tornado. Reputable local contractors must be well-versed in navigating Indiana building codes and insurance claims. The climate necessitates durable materials like impact-resistant shingles and standing-seam metal roofs to protect against frequent weather events. The market is competitive with a mix of long-standing local companies and regional providers serving the area.

1What is the typical cost range for a new asphalt shingle roof on an average-sized home in Aurora?

For a standard 2,000-2,500 sq. ft. home in Aurora, a full asphalt shingle roof replacement typically ranges from $8,500 to $15,000. This range accounts for local material and labor costs, the complexity of your roof (like valleys or dormers common in older Aurora homes), and the quality of shingles chosen. It's crucial to get multiple detailed, written estimates from local contractors, as prices can vary based on the specific challenges of your property and current material supply factors.

2When is the best time of year to schedule a roof replacement in Aurora, Indiana?

The ideal windows for roofing in Aurora are late spring (May-June) and early fall (September-October). These periods typically offer the most stable, dry weather, which is critical for proper installation. Avoiding the peak of summer heat (which can make shingles too pliable) and the winter months is wise due to Indiana's unpredictable cold, rain, and potential for ice. Scheduling well in advance of these prime seasons is recommended, as reputable local roofers' calendars fill up quickly.

3Are there any specific local building codes or regulations in Aurora I need to be aware of for a roof replacement?

Yes, Aurora enforces building codes, and a permit is generally required for a full roof replacement. Your roofing contractor should handle this process with the City of Aurora Building Department. Key local considerations include ensuring proper wind uplift resistance for our region (Aurora is in a high-wind zone per Indiana code) and adhering to requirements for ice and water shield at the eaves in specific climates. A reputable local roofer will be fully versed in these codes and pull all necessary permits.

4How do I choose a reliable roofing contractor in the Aurora area?

Prioritize contractors who are licensed, insured, and have a long-standing physical address in the region. Ask for references from recent jobs in Aurora or nearby communities like Lawrenceburg or Greendale. Verify they are a credentialed installer for the major shingle manufacturers (like GAF or Owens Corning), which often provides enhanced warranty coverage. Always check their rating with the Better Business Bureau and read local reviews to gauge their reputation for quality and communication.

5What are the most common types of roof damage you see on homes in Aurora, and how can I prevent them?

The most frequent issues are wind damage from Ohio River Valley storms, granule loss from aging asphalt shingles, and leaks caused by failing flashing around chimneys, vents, and skylights. Seasonal temperature swings and humidity can also accelerate wear. To prevent major problems, we recommend a professional inspection at least every two years, especially after severe weather events. Keeping gutters clean and ensuring proper attic ventilation are also key to extending your roof's lifespan in our climate.
